I have a special focus on religious trauma and related issues. I am EMDR trained and for some, this will be the main approach to therapy. However, it is not my only approach. Religious trauma is usually a complex trauma, or as I often say, trauma by 1000 paper cuts. Therefore, it's important for us to build trust and rapport, and to go slow.

Trauma is an emotional and psychological response to an event. This event could be something you experienced personally or something you witnessed. Your experience could include shock, denial, unpredictable emotions, flashbacks, nightmares, strained relationships and even physical symptoms like headaches or nausea. Trauma and PTSD therapists in Lakeside, California Statistics
Trauma and PTSD therapists in Lakeside, California average 15 years of experience and charge around $207 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(61%), Psychodynamic Therapy (42%), and Existential / Humanistic Therapy (36%).
